Can this hunt happen right up to the end of the year or does the weather preclude that?

Last hunting day is 31st December.. it’s rained already and will probably rain some more .. it’s a gamble to some degree depending where and how much it rains .. sometimes more elephants move in the area and sometimes they disappear.. I’ll say this though some of the big tuskers venture far and wide during the rains ..
